The Data Scientist leverages advanced analytics, statistical modeling, machine learning, and AI to solve complex business challenges and enable data‑driven decision‑making across the organization. This role develops, validates, and deploys predictive and statistical models using Python, while also performing hands‑on data analysis, data extraction, and ad‑hoc reporting using Python, SQL, and Excel. Working closely with cross‑functional business partners, the Data Scientist translates business questions into analytical solutions, delivering actionable insights that support strategic initiatives and operational decision‑making.
The role is responsible for owning the end‑to‑end modeling lifecycle, including problem definition, data preparation, model development, validation, performance evaluation, and communication of results to both technical and non‑technical audiences. The ideal candidate combines strong expertise in data science, machine learning, and statistical analysis with practical proficiency in Python, SQL, and Excel. They are intellectually curious, analytical, and comfortable working with complex datasets to uncover meaningful insights.
Success in this role requires the ability to quickly develop domain expertise in the housing industry, collaborate effectively with business stakeholders, and translate technical findings into clear, impactful recommendations that drive business value.
